PDA

View Full Version : سوال: ساختمان داده و درخت ها در ++c



mehran_h
پنج شنبه 03 دی 1394, 18:25 عصر
سلام ببخشید یه تکه کد نوشتم برا درست کردن درخت دودویی و درج در ان میخواستم ببینم درسته یا نه و بعدش اگه درسته در main چه گونه مقدارش باید بدم دقیقا اون جایی که *****گذاشتم ممنون میشم جواب بدید



// ConsoleApplication1.cpp : Defines the entry point for the console application.
//

#include "stdafx.h"
#include "conio.h"
#include "iostream"
using namespace std;

struct tree_node
{
char info;
tree_node *left,*right;
};
tree_node *root;

void tree_insert(tree_node *node,tree_node *left,tree_node *right,int data)
{
if(node==NULL)
{

root->right=right;
root->left=left;
root->info=data;
}
else
{
node-> right=right;
node-> left=left;
node-> info=data;
}
}

void _tmain()
{
char ch;
cout<<"enter char"<<endl;
cin>>ch;
while (ch!='0')
{
********
cin>>ch;
}
_getch();
}